About "postponement of periods"
Periods may be required to be postponed in certain situations such as beach holiday, wedding, pilgrimage, sports tournaments or travel. Commonly, it is done by the use of a prescription-only pill called Norethisterone given in a specific dose.
Norethisterone is a progestin medication that is to be taken three days before the menstruation is due. It can be continued until the event is over, for a maximum of 14 to 20 days since its commencement. Periods will return once the medication is stopped.
It is not safe for some women to postpone their period by this method, especially if they are taking other drugs,
contraceptive pills or have a family history of blood clots. It is therefore imperative to consult a specialist to assess your suitability.
